montages (Meaning)
montages
a rapid succession of distinct scenes or images in a motion picture to illustrate associated ideas, a literary, musical, or artistic composite (see composite entry 2 sense 1) of juxtaposed more or less heterogeneous elements, the production of a rapid succession of images in a motion picture to illustrate an association of ideas, to combine into or depict in a montage, an artistic composition made up of several different kinds of items (as strips of newspaper, pictures, bits of wood) arranged together, a heterogeneous mixture, a composite picture made by combining several separate pictures
